What Is Taskade, And What Does It Do?
Taskade is an all-in-one task management app that allows users to create to-do lists, set deadlines, and collaborate with others in real-time.
It claims to be the fastest way to get work done.
It’s a cloud-based service that offers reliability and accessibility to help individuals and remote teams collaborate in one integrated space.

How Much Does It Cost?
Taskade offers three pricing plans:
- Free (free for all team members)
- Unlimited ($5 per seat per month)
- Enterprise ($20 per seat per month, coming soon)
You can pay monthly or benefit from a $4 discount per year in the Unlimited plan by paying annually.
Free
The Free plan includes:
- Unlimited Tasks & Projects
- Unlimited Folders & Teams
- Unlimited Members & Guests
- Templates, Calendar, Repeat Tasks
- Real-time Collaboration
Unlimited
The Unlimited plan includes all the above plus:
- Version History
- Large File Uploads
- Advanced Permission
- 2-Way Calendar Integration
Enterprise
The Enterprise plan includes all the above plus:
- Flexible payment options
- Custom contract
- SAML SSO, SCIM
Taskade Reviews
On Trustpilot, Taskade has a rating of 4.4/5 stars, based on just 11 reviews.
Its users seem to be satisfied with it.
They find it easy to use, very affordable and benefit from the fact that you can manage everything within the app.
Moreover, their support team seems to be doing a great job.
One user mentioned some difficulties they faced while trying to change their settings.
However, this review was published back in 2019. Plus, this user was satisfied overall.
At the time of writing this article, no reviews were found on Trustradius.
Are There Any Alternatives?
Here are some of the most popular task management software options available on the market:
Asana
Asana helps teams understand what to do, why it’s important, and how to accomplish it.
There is a free plan and two paid plans starting at $10.99 per user per month.
Trello
Trello aids in the process of getting work done.
There is a free plan and three paid plans starting at $5 per user per month.
Basecamp
Basecamp is an all-in-one software for remote workers.
There is a 30 day trial and a paid plan at $99 per month flat.
